IE Team to Mozilla: Congratulations!
Posted By:
Dan Fernandez
|
Jun 18th, 2008 @ 9:27 AM
|
52,158
Views |
9
Comments
In what has now become a tradition, the Internet Explorer team sent a "
Congratulations on Shipping!
" cake to the Mozilla Foundation headquarters for shipping Mozilla Firefox 3.0. As you might be able to see in the picture, the ring around the Internet Explorer "e" is actually three-dimensional and it's certainly more fancy than the cake they previously sent
Mozilla for shipping Firefox 2
.
